Character
Shakti brings amber and vanilla together with ylang-ylang, blood orange, cedar, and cedarmoss in a blend that feels warm and slightly powdery. The citrus brightens the resinous base without turning it sharp, while the yellow floral note adds a soft, rounded depth that keeps the sweetness from becoming heavy. Cedar and cedarmoss give the composition a dry, woody backbone that balances the spice and the sugar. It wears close and personal rather than loud, with a texture that feels natural and a little earthy. The overall impression is cozy and intimate, suited to someone who likes their gourmand scents tempered by wood and pollen. It is not for anyone who wants a crisp, clean, or aggressively modern profile, and it will feel out of place in a bright, minimal setting.
